Maremma Beach

Maremma Beach is a sandy beach known for its ample space and tranquil atmosphere, making it an ideal location for those seeking a relaxing beach experience. The beach is easily accessible with convenient parking available across the road. A unique feature of this beach is the pathway from the parking lot through a picturesque pine forest, adding to the overall charm of the location. However, visitors should be aware that the beach is in close proximity to a ship dock, which may slightly affect the unobscured views.

The beach offers amenities such as umbrellas and loungers, although these come at an additional cost. A small beach restaurant is also available on-site, offering affordable meals. Despite the presence of these amenities, visitors are advised to bring their own umbrellas for a more cost-effective beach experience. It should be noted that the water at Maremma Beach can be quite cloudy, which may impact the overall beach experience for some visitors.

Where to Stay near Maremma Beach?

Beach enthusiasts visiting Maremma Beach often choose to stay in the nearby coastal town of Grosseto, which offers a range of accommodations and is just a short drive away. Others might prefer the charming village of Castiglione della Pescaia, known for its medieval architecture and vibrant local culture, making it a perfect base for exploring both the beach and the surrounding Tuscan countryside.
